A Good Girl's Guide to Murder by Holly Jackson is a debut mystery thriller that follows Pip, a high school student who decides to investigate a closed murder case for her school project. The case involves Andie Bell, a girl found dead five years earlier, with her boyfriend Sal Singh convicted and subsequently killed before he could appeal. Pip becomes convinced that the wrong person was blamed, and she begins her own investigation into what really happened that night.

Jackson builds tension through Pip's interviews with key witnesses, her discovery of contradictory evidence, and her growing realization that the truth may be far more complicated and dangerous than the official narrative. The novel alternates between Pip's present-day investigation and transcripts from her interviews, creating a dual narrative structure that keeps readers engaged. As Pip digs deeper, she uncovers secrets that people in her small town would prefer remained buried, putting her own safety at risk.

The book appeals to readers who enjoy atmospheric mysteries with unreliable witnesses, moral ambiguity, and a protagonist who refuses to accept easy answers. Jackson's writing captures the voice of a determined teenager whose academic curiosity transforms into a personal quest for justice.

  • Mystery thriller with dual narrative structure
  • First in the Pip series
  • Published 2019; won multiple YA and mystery awards
  • Approximately 464 pages
  • Themes: justice, truth, obsession, small-town secrets
